客户端输入:
服务器返回消息:
functionsend(){
alert(2);
}varwebSocket;if(window.WebSocket){
webSocket= newWebSocket("ws://127.0.0.1:2048/ws");//客户端收到服务器的方法,这个方法就会被回调
webSocket.onmessage= function(ev) {varcontents=document.getElementById("responseText");
contents.value=contents.value+"\n"+ev.data;
}
webSocket.onopen= function(ev) {varcontents=document.getElementById("responseText");
contents.value= "与服务器端的websocket连接建立";vardata= '{"method":"init","identifier":"11VKF7M0020199"}';
webSocket.send(data);
}
webSocket.onclose= function(ev) {varcontents=document.getElementById("responseText");
contents.value=contents.value+"\n"+ "与服务器端的websocket连接断开";
}
}else{
alert("该环境不支持websocket")
}functionsendMessage() {//alert(document.getElementById("message").value);
if(window.webSocket){if(webSocket.readyState==WebSocket.OPEN){vardata2= '{"method":"video","serialNumber":"yjdp"}';vardata= '{"method":"video","identifier":"11VKF7M0020199","toIdentifier":"yjdp","status":"'+document.getElementById("message").value+'","url":"http://127.0.0.1:8081/UAV_FILES/FILES/0UYKG7K002001F.mp4"}';
webSocket.send(data);
}else{
alert("与服务器连接尚未建立")
}
}
}